Title :
Nonlinear FET modeling-a mixture of art and science

Abstract :
Summary form only given. The nonlinear FET modeling work directed toward development of computer-aided-design (CAD) techniques was surveyed. Emphasis was given to microwave applications, although FET models for digital circuits were also discussed. Particular attention was given to active device modeling; equivalent circuit models (complexity, calibration, and verification); and applications of GaAs FET models in commercial simulators for the design and optimization of hybrid and MMIC (monolithic microwave integrated circuit) circuits.<>
